Can I Benefit from Chin Implants?

Chin implants (also known as chin augmentation) often accompany rhinoplasties in order to achieve a more “balanced” look for the face. A “weak” chin can make a nose appear to protrude out of the face. Chin implants can be achieved through surgery or fillers. Surgery has longer-lasting results but does require a longer recovery period. Ideal candidates that may benefit from chin implants are patients with significant asymmetrical faces or short chins.

Can I Benefit from Cheek Implants?

Just like chin implants, cheek implants are also often performed with rhinoplasty surgery. Even making minor adjustments to the cheek can have a dramatically improved effect on facial appearance. Well-defined cheekbones are a desired trait that can have significant anti-aging qualities.

By lifting the skin and smoothing out the lines, the skin will look tighter and younger. Fillers are another option for sunken cheeks but their effects are not as long-lasting as surgery. The ideal candidate that may benefit from cheek implants are patients with flat cheeks, flat facial structure, and asymmetrical facial imbalance.

Should I Combine Procedures?

That’s a question only you and your surgeon can answer. However, combining procedures can produce enhanced results within a single recovery period. Many patients find that they do not need additional downtime for cheek and chin implants after having rhinoplasty surgery. You’ll spend less time recovering and enjoying your newly improved, proportionate face.
